As a quick note, by preventative maintenance, we mean thorough cleaning of the unit after usage, storing with an anti-corrosive material ( Pump Armour), and applying lubricant ( Throat Seal Liquid) before each use. Your pump packings are a combination of leather and plastic seals that keep that Graco pressure perfectly maintained during normal operation.
